WARNING
Ÿ Read all instrucons before using this heater!
Ÿ This heater is hot when in use. To avoid burns, DO NOT let bare skin
touch hot surfaces. If provided, use handles when moving this
heater. Keep combusble materials, such as furniture, pillows,
bedding, papers, clothes, and curtains at least 3 feet (0.9m) from the
front of the heater, and keep them away from the sides and rear.
Ÿ Extreme cauon is necessary when any heater is used by or near
children or invalids and whenever the heater is leoperang and
unaended.
Ÿ DO NOT operate any heater with a damaged cord or plug or aer
the heater malfuncons, has been dropped or damaged in any
manner. Discard heater, or return to authorized service facility for
examinaon and/or repair.
Ÿ DO NOT run power cord under carpeng. DO NOT cover power cord
with throw rugs, runners, or similar coverings. DO NOT route power
cord under furniture or appliances. Arrange power cord away from
trac area, and where it will not be tripped over.
Ÿ DO NOT insert or allow foreign objects to enter any venlaon or
exhaust opening, as this may cause electric shock or re, or
damage the heater.
Ÿ To prevent a possible re, DO NOT block air intakes or exhaust in
any manner. Doing so could cause a re. DO NOT use on so
surfaces, like a bed, where openings may become blocked.
Ÿ A heater has hot and arcing or sparking parts inside. DO NOT use it
in areas where gasoline, paint, or ammable liquids are used or
stored.
Ÿ Use this heater only as described in this manual. Any other use not
recommended by the manufacturer may cause re, electric shock,
or injury to persons.
Ÿ ALWAYS plug heaters directly into a wall outlet/receptacle.
NEVER..use with an extension cord or relocatable power tap

(outlet/power strip).
Ÿ Connect to properly grounded outlets ONLY.
Ÿ DO NOT place the heater near a bed because objects such as
pillows or blankets can fall off the bed and be ignited by the heater.
Ÿ NEVER use this heater in bathrooms, laundry rooms, or any other
locaon where the heater could fall into a bathtub or pool, become
damp, or come in contact with water.
Ÿ AVOID FIRE! Regularly inspect all air vents to make sure they are
free from dust, lint, or other blockage. Unplug the unit and clean
with a vacuum ONLY. DO NOT rinse or get wet.
Ÿ WARNING: DO NOT DEPEND ON THE POWER SWITCH THE SOLE
MEANS OF DISCO NNEC T I NG POWER WHEN SERV ICING O R
MOVING THE HEATER. ALWAYS UNPLUG THE POWER CORD.
Ÿ WARNING: REDUCE THE RISK OF FIRE OR ELECTRIC SHOCK---DO NOT
USE THIS HEATER WITH ANY SOLID STATE SPEED CONTROL DEVICES.
Ÿ For residenal use only! NOT for commercial use! Any commercial
or public use of this heater voids all warranes, and could cause
injury.
Ÿ This product is not intended to be a primary heat source. It is for
supplemental heat only.
Ÿ INDOOR use only! NEVER use this heater outdoors! Doing so may
result in electric shock!
Ÿ Risk of electric shock! DO NOT OPEN! No user-serviceable parts
inside!
Ÿ NEVER modify this heater. Doing so could result in personal injury
or property damage. Modicaon of this replace completely
voids all warranes.
Ÿ ALWAYS turn this heater off before unplugging it from the outlet.
Ÿ ALWAYS disconnect this unit from the power supply before
performing any assembly or cleaning, or before relocang the
electric fireplace.
Ÿ NEVER leave this heater unaended. ALWAYS unplug this heater
when not in use.
background
3
Ÿ ALWAYS store this heater in a dry locaon. NEVER use the replace
if it has become wet.
Ÿ ONLY use this heater on a 120V AC 15-Amp circuit. NEVER overload
the circuit. If this heater trips the circuit breaker, unplug all other
appliances on the same circuit before the next use. Avoid plugging
other appliances into the same circuit as this heater.
Ÿ NEVER plug this heater into an outlet that is old, cracked, or has any
loose wires or connecons. Plugging this heater into a faulty
outlet could result in electric arcing within the outlet that could
cause the outlet to overheat or catch fire.
Ÿ ALWAYS check your heater cord and plug connecons with each use!
1. MAKE SURE the plug ts ght in the outlet! Faulty wall outlet
connecons or loose plugs can cause the outlet to overheat.
2. Heaters draw more current than small appliances. Overheang
may occur even if it has not occurred with the use of other
appliances.
3. During use check frequently to see if the plug outlet or faceplate
is HOT!
4. If the outlet or faceplate is HOT, disconnue use immediately and
have a qualied electrician inspect and/or replace the faulty
outlets.
This heater has a polarized plug
(on e bl a d e is wider tha n t h e
other). As a safety feature to
reduce the risk of electrical shock,
this plug is intended to t in a
polarized outlet only one way. If
the plug does not t fully in the
outlet, reverse the plug. If it sll
does not t, contact a qualied
electrician. Do not aempt to
defeat this safety feature.

1) Locang the Appliance
Your new electric replace may be installed virtually anywhere in
your home. However, when choosing a locaon, ensure that the
general instrucons for safety are followed.
Ÿ For best results, install out of direct sunlight, water or very
damp air.
Ÿ Power supply service must be installed within proximity of
electric fireplace prior to finishing avoiding reconstrucon.
2) Locate an outlet
Ÿ Plug in (you may run the power cord out of the framed wall
opening to an exisng outlet or install an outlet on a nearby wall
stud within the wall). The circuit should be 120v 15amp.
Ÿ The power cord is 6 long. If the cord is not long enough to
reach the outlet, a grounded extension cord minimum AWG No.
14 wiring and rated to a minimum or 1875 was may be used,
please kindly noted that it should not be longer than 7.87.
Ÿ Make sure the outlet is in good condion and that the plug is not
loose. NEVER exceed the maximum amperage for the circuit. DO
NOT plug other appliances into the same circuit.

Temperature Liming Control
This heater is equipped with a Temperature Liming Control. Should
the heater reach an unsafe temperature, the heater will automacally
turn OFF. To reset:
Ÿ Unplug the power cord from the outlet.
Ÿ Turn the Power Switch on the CONTROL PANEL to OFF. Wait at least
5 minutes.
Ÿ Inspect the replace to make sure no vents are blocked, or clogged
with dust or lint. If they are, use a vacuum to clean the vent areas.
Ÿ With the Power Switch in the OFF posion, plug the power cord
back into the outlet.
If it switches o again, UNPLUG THE HEATER RIGHT AWAY! Have the
outlets, wiring, and breaker box inspected by a professional. Make
necessary repairs before using the heater.

Cleaning
NEVER immerse in water or spray with water. Doing so could
result in electric shock, fire, or personal injury.
Metal:
Ÿ Bu using a so cloth, slightly dampened with a citrus oil-based
product.
Ÿ DO NOT use brass polish or household cleaners as these products
will damage the metal trim.
Glass:
Ÿ Use a good quality glass cleaner and dry thoroughly with a paper
towel or lint-free cloth.
Ÿ NEVER use abrasive cleansers, liquid sprays, or any cleaner that
could scratch the surface.
Plasc:
Ÿ Wipe gently with a slightly damp cloth and a mild soluon of dish
soap and warm water.
Ÿ NEVER use abrasive cleansers, liquid sprays, or any cleaner that
could scratch the surface.
Vents:
Ÿ Use a vacuum or duster to remove dust and dirt from the heater and
vent areas.
Ÿ Clean the exterior of the replace with a slightly damp cloth or
duster.

1. The remote does not work and the new unit we just got cannot be
turned on.
1) Make sure the main power switch on the top right behind the
fence is on.
2) There would be a long beep when the main power switch is
turned on.
3) If there is no beep, the connecters on the PCB board might be
loosen, please contact service team for a checking instrucon.
4) If there is a beep and the control panel can be used but the
remote is not working, the remote is not working either close
or far, please contact service team for help.
2. My old unit no longer works, it cannot power on.
1) Check the power cord to see if it is well.

2) If the power cord is ne, check the wires behind the rocker
switch to see if they are burned.
3) If the wires are well, too, the PCB board might be broken and
need to be replaced. Please contact service team for a
replacement and instrucon.
3. The heater does not work, it turns on for several seconds then shuts
off itself.
1) New product:
a. Turn the thermostat to 8 to see if the heater will work
connuously.
b. If not, unplug the unit for a whole night.
c. If sll not, contact service team for a checking instrucon,
the fan assembly should be checked.
2) Product has been used for some me:
a. Open the top panel to check if the fan can move smoothly or
the heater motor is well connected.
b. If yes, pull othe CN3 connecter plugged on the PCB board.
If the heater works, the buon panel should be replaced.
c. If the heater sll does not work aer unplugging the CN3
connecter, please contact service team for a further
soluon.
4. There is no air coming out when turn the heater on.
1) New product:
a. Conrm if the air outlet feels warm or there is something
geng red inside when the heater is turned on. If yes, the
fan is stuck or the heat motor is not in right posion.
b. If not, check the heater connecters on PCB board. Unplug
and replug all connecters to see if the heater will work.
2) Product has been used for some me:
a. Conrm if the air outlet feels warm or there is something
geng red inside when the heater is turned on. If yes, the
fan is stuck or the heat motor is not in right posion.
b. If not, please contact service team for help.
5. The heater does not come back even the room is already cold.
Turn the thermostat to 8 to see if the heater will work connuously,
if yes, the sensor is malfuncon, if not, please contact service team
